No, there is no direct bus from Kirkham to Wrexham station. However, there are services departing from Market Square and arriving at Wrexham Bus Station 7 via Bus Station, Bus Station, Whitechapel and Railway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 27m.
No, there is no direct train from Kirkham to Wrexham. However, there are services departing from Kirkham & Wesham and arriving at Wrexham General via Preston, Warrington Bank Quay and Chester.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 17m.
The distance between Kirkham and Wrexham is 65 miles. The road distance is 70.6 miles.
